Coronet guinea pigs are longhaired guinea pigs with a striking resemblance to silkie guinea pigs as they inherit the characteristic coat of silkies. Besides their physical beauty, coronet guinea pigs are social, playful, gentle animals who adapt quickly to family life and regular handling. But unlike silkies, they have a rosette or coronet “small crown” of hair on their forehead.
